I don't understand how these two consecutive patches works.
My motivation is to report more clearly when a necessary
executable is missing.  If i don't have installed "jpegtran"
(image-dired-cmd-rotate-original-program) and i call
image-dired-rotate-original
i get the message: "Could not rotate image"

Assume I don't have "convert". Before the patches Emacs would complain,
and installing ImageMagick would fix the complaint.
After, Emacs will complain about not finding "convert", but after I
install ImageMagick Emacs will keep complaining, because the defcustom
will still be nil. Is this intended?  Or am I misunderstanding something?
Good point.  I agree is a nuisance having to set those values
after installing the executable.
How about following more simple patch?:
It just check for the required executable at the top of each function
using it; it signals an error if the executable is not found:
